Student Dies Hours After Getting Tattoo

Most young people submit their bodies to tattooing without a thought that something could go wrong, but the sudden death of a 23 year-old Italian student just hours after getting a tattoo proves things can indeed go terribly wrong.

The Daily Mail is reporting on the case of Federica Iammatteo, a student from Milan, who was described as being "energetic and sporty" and who was in perfect health when she went to a tattoo parlor on Thursday, April 18, for another tattoo.

However, by Friday morning, she complained of feeling "shivery" and of sensations like pins and needles in her hands and feet. She sent a text to a friend saying she had a fever, but when her symptoms became worse as the day wore on, her family sought medical help.

No sooner had she arrived at the hospital when she began to hemorrhage and was immediately transported to Policlinica, Milan's top hospital.

But it was already too late. She was suffering from septic shock and at 3:00 a.m. on Saturday morning, she passed away.

"You don’t die like this at 23 years old," said her father, Agostino Iammatteo. "She was full of energy, sporty. We want to know what happened."

He does not appear to be blaming the tattoo parlor: "My daughter didn’t lack money to go to a proper centre where it was more than safe to get a tattoo and she had already had others done there."

So what happened to Federica?

Thus far, authorities have few clues and have ordered an autopsy to take place this week.

Police visited the tattoo clinic but found no evidence of unhygienic practices.

According to the Mayo Clinic, tattoos can cause problems ranging from allergic reactions to dyes to infections and transmission of blood-borne diseases due to  improperly sterilized instruments.

Plenty of Americans are willing to take these risks. In July of 2012, it was estimated that 45 million Americans had a least one tattoo, spending an estimated $1.65 billion on the practice in any one of the nation's 21,000 parlors.
